Occupational Therapy Assistant Responsibilities:
- Plan and administer treatment to residents and patients with temporary or long-term disabilities to relieve pain, restore or improve function, and promote healing.
- Provides skilled occupational therapy services/interventions in accordance with physician orders under the supervision of an Occupational Therapist
- Responds to requests for service by relaying information and referrals to Occupational Therapist
- Assure all treatment is delivered in accordance with an established plan of care.
- Provide clinical support and instruct patients, families, and caregivers.
- Monitor patient response to treatment intervention.
- Complete required forms and documentation in accordance with company policy and state/federal regulations
- Attend required meetings as designated by the Director of Rehab.
Occupational Therapy Assistant Skills:
- SNF/Long term care experience preferred.
- Current knowledge of treatment practices
- Knowledge of Net Health Electronic Documentation System preferred.
- Ability to manage patients with different types of personalities.
Occupational Therapy Assistant Requirements:
- Active/Valid Texas license as Occupational Therapy Assistant
- Valid certification as a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ant (COTA)
- In good standing with all regulatory agencies and licensing boards
